psytrance has to be split up in various parts before it can be analyzed. if we talk about the old goa trance sound it's definatly almost dead. it had it glorious days but they ended. at the same time the psytrance that most people refer to as full on trance emerged and gained huge part of the market. it was quickly flooded by all israeli acts.
but the old psytrance sound (such as Hallucinogen, X-Dream, The Delta etc) still lives on and is more exprimental today. Just listen to X-Dreams latest album. It borrow loads of elements from electro.
Personally I'm quite fed up with the full on sound atm. not many really good releases out there nowadays. |
